Using a walking pad and standing desk (click through the next post) Properly

A walking pad and standing desks are excellent ways to ease back pain, increase circulation, and keep the heart healthy while working. Choosing the right one, however, is essential.

You need to select a pad that is appropriate for your space and is made to your body's shape. You will have the same issues when you stand stationary as if you were sitting all day.

Reduces Joint Stiffness

During the COVID-19 epidemic there were many who worked from home and discovered that sitting for long periods of time was bad for their backs. Some people wore a treadmill to reduce the health risks associated with sedentary work. They're great however, it's crucial to use them properly to avoid stiff joints.

Altering your posture and standing often allows the muscles in your legs and feet to relax and contract, which helps to circulate the blood and reduce pain and discomfort. Moving around and standing often allow your feet and legs to contract and relax. This aids in circulation of blood and reduces discomfort and pain. Walking pads can be utilized in conjunction with a treadmill to keep your joints supple and flexible throughout the day.

Many people who spend their entire day on a computer experience muscle strains, which can cause pains in their necks, shoulders and lower back. These people may also experience issues with their wrists, hands, or elbows. These issues can be caused by poor posture and bad habits, such as turning their shoulders when typing. Using a walking pad and an upright desk can help avoid these issues and improve productivity.

Being in a standing position for long periods of time can be uncomfortable, especially in shoes that are uncomfortable. Knee pain could be caused by an unforgiving surface that presses down on your feet, which could lead to fatigue and pain. A padded mat can be affixed to your desk to help spread the weight of your feet across the entire surface. This will help prevent injuries.

A stiff kneecap can cause knee pain while working at a computer. This can lead to stiffness, pain, and even arthritis. By keeping your knees in neutral position, a mat for walking and adjusting the height of your chair can prevent this type of condition. Additionally having frequent breaks to walk around can aid.

Increases Productivity

If you spend long hours at your desk using a treadmill or a standing desk can increase your productivity. They get you moving while working, which improves blood circulation and allows you to stay alert and focused. They can also help you burn off more calories and lose weight, so they can be an effective way to boost your health and fitness while at work.

Many people have trouble getting enough exercise throughout the day due to hectic schedules and long hours at work. They can be affected by a variety of health issues, like obesity and back pain due to sitting for long periods of time. However, treadmill desks can help you overcome these challenges and make your workday more productive.

Studies have shown that people who use treadmill desks have lower stress levels, and are more productive and creative than those who do not. This is because walking helps increase the growth of new brain cells, which boosts your mental alertness and boosts your memory. In addition, walking regularly can help reduce the chance of cognitive decline and depression.

It's essential that you take regular breaks while sitting and standing all through the day to ensure you are working effectively. It's also crucial to watch your posture and adjust the level of your walking pad as necessary to avoid stress on your legs and back.

Select a compact and lightweight treadmill when looking for one. It's easy to transport and fit under your desk. It's also important to pick an item that is quiet, so that it doesn't disturb your colleagues.

A treadmill that folds under the desk is an excellent option for smaller living spaces. It is easy to move and can be used wherever in the home office or at a house shared with a friend. The WalkingPad A1 Pro can be folded down to 4.7 inch thick, making it ideal for smaller spaces. It's also extremely solid and secure, so you can rest assured that it won't fall.

Burns Calories

Standing while working can take some time to get used to, but it helps reduce back and neck pain. It also improves posture and increases energy. In a research conducted at a call center that employed employees who used desks that could stand were less prone to back pain and were more productive than colleagues who used regular desks. This is no surprise since prolonged sitting has been linked to several health risks, including obesity and heart disease.

A standing desk could burn up to 200 calories more each day than a traditional workstation. This is due to the fact that it requires you to move more frequently than sitting. It also forces you use your legs and engage your core muscles, which leads to a higher metabolic rate. The good thing is that it's easier and cheaper to stand up at a desk than to get into a gym to workout.

Despite burning more calories while standing however, it's important to remember that it's not an exercise substitute and will only put a small dent in your calorie count if you are overweight. Standing for too long can cause discomfort in the joints and feet. You can purchase an elevated mat to elevate the surface of your chair and alleviate pressure on your legs as well as feet.

In the office, people who are on their feet more often tend to interact with their colleagues more than those who sit for most of the day. This can boost morale and promote collaboration and communication. This is particularly useful in a highly complex workplace that requires a high degree of collaboration and problem solving.

Salo for instance, is known for its treadmill desks, which let employees respond to emails or catch up on messages while walking at their desks. In addition to being more productive, the company's culture of moving creates a sense of camaraderie and excitement in its workplace. This has a positive effect on employee performance as employees feel more enthusiastic and enthusiastic about their work.

Reduces Noise

Many people are interested in the benefits of walking while they work but are worried about how they can incorporate it into their routines. The walking pads available for purchase enable you to walk without distracting colleagues or hindering your ability to finish your work.

These mats under desks are smaller and fit comfortably under your desk, in contrast to larger exercise equipment like treadmills. These pads are more quiet and ideal for office use. Some even come with wheels that allow for easy storage or relocation when not in use.

The motor of the under-desk pads has been designed to produce a minimum amount of noise when walking or running. This is crucial because a noisy pad could disturb your ability to concentrate on your work. Furthermore, a noisy pad could increase your fatigue risk and decrease the efficiency of your work.

To make sure you don't get this, look for models with a powerful motor capable of handling your work demands while keeping the noise level low. The belt's material should be checked to determine whether it's able to absorb impacts and shocks.

With a little effort you can learn to walk and work simultaneously. Be aware that working while walking can make your fine motor skills harder. So, if you're just starting out, it's best to start with easy tasks and then gradually increase the difficulty of your work.

Apart from being comfortable and ergonomic walking treadmill with desk while working is also known to improve your mental health. According to studies, walking 9.800 steps a day can reduce your risk of developing dementia by half. It is important to break free from a lifestyle of sedentary living and include walking into your daily routine.

Although it might be difficult to find the ideal treadmill-desk combination for your needs, the good news is that there's a wide range of options online. Spend some time researching the features of each one and then choose the one that is best for you. For instance, you can think about the weight capacity, incline settings speed limits, and other important aspects before making your final decision.
